On May 13, 2022, a Quicksilver Aircraft Co SPORT 2S (N202JC) was involved in an accident near Osawatomie, KS. The accident resulted in 1 serious injury, 1 minor injury. The aircraft sustained substantial damage.
The National Transportation Safety Board determined the probable cause of this accident to be: The loss of engine power due to fuel exhaustion and the pilot’s failure to maintain control of the airplane during a forced landing which resulted in an aerodynamic stall.
